Knowle Ladies FC are looking for an enthusiastic, dedicated and positive person to take on the role of team manager for the 18/19 season onwards.
The team were formed in 2001 and are a close knit, eager and talented side made up of a range of ages. Knowle Ladies play in the West Midlands Regional Premier League, matches are on a Sunday afternoons and they currently train one evening a week.
We are looking for someone with the drive and desire to take the team forward and help us develop the female section of the club as a whole.
The key priorities for the successful candidate would be to:
• develop, improve and expand the current playing squad whilst continuing to foster an excellent team bond
• work together with the club’s youth section to build links and create a route from junior to senior football for female players
• play a part of shaping the future of Knowle FC as a member of the club’s management committee
You must hold a relevant coaching qualification and we expect you to be able to display a can do attitude, a passion for promoting women’s football and good communication skills.
